Job Description

As a Retail Graphic Designer with Opry Entertainment Group (OEG), you'll serve as a key creative player on the retail team, designing unique and custom graphics for products that connect artists and fans in our iconic venues. You'll create original artwork and graphics for apparel, hardgoods, packaging, retail displays, e-commerce visuals, and other marketing materials. You'll work closely with the product development team to ensure cohesive design across categories, efficiently incorporating current trend within the brand aesthetic. As the ideal candidate, you bring strong graphic design skills across printables and pattern design with an eye for retail trends and merchandising. Reports to Senior Product Designer. - Create original designs, including logos and compositional graphics for apparel and other products. Produce 10--20 new styles per month in alignment with the creative direction of the product design team. - Follow existing style guides to create new designs and accompanying style guides for packaging. - Research current trends consistent with existing brand aesthetic to be incorporated into original artwork for the fan experience. - Stay current with graphic design trends, tools, and product applications, while maintaining existing brand aesthetic. - Collaborate with retail, marketing, and cross-functional teams to deliver high-quality end products. - Communicate with product development team and vendors to ensure proper execution of prints and applications. - Design and prepare supplemental artwork for websites, banners, social media, in-store collateral, and product packaging. - Create CADs and tech packs to communicate graphic placement on garments. Adapt and supply CADs for our e-commerce team as needed. Adjust vendor art and logos as required for various souvenir products. - Create production-ready artwork for film output related to textile screen printing and other decorations methods. - Proofread, compare, and verify the accuracy of all details, such as font type, graphic size, color, copy, and logo specifications for all jobs assigned. - Perform other duties as assigned. Education - Degree in Graphic Design or related field preferred Experience - 4+ years' graphic design experience required, preferably in fashion or lifestyle apparel - 2+ years' designing apparel and soft goods, with practical knowledge of screen-printing and other decoration techniques - Experience in retail product design and manufacturing required - PDF and/or online portfolio is required Knowledge, Skills and Abilities - Effective inter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ills - Strong understanding of country music and entertainment lifestyle and the OEG brand aesthetic is a plus - Proven success working with cross-functional teams and adapting projects to evolving expectations - Strong organizational skills and meticulous attention to detail, with the ability to successfully manage multiple concurrent workstreams while meeting critical deadlines - Working knowledge of printing best practices across various product mediums, including awareness of related production and print limitations - Proficient with Adobe products (Photoshop and Illustrator) and Microsoft Office Suite - Able to work a flexible schedule, including evenings, weekends, and holidays, to support business needs Physical Requirements Speak and hear to communicate and use both near and far vision. Frequently sit with some walking and standing for office/property navigation. Occasionally lift/carry up to 25 lbs. Continually use gross motor skills with frequent use of bi-manual dexterity and fine motor skills for computer use. Working Conditions In-office position based in a corporate environment with individual workspaces and shared common areas which support focused work while encouraging regular interaction among colleagues. Moderate background noise typical of a collaborative office setting.
